VISA is clearly a very strong leader in the payment industry, and is in a fast pace of technology transformation.  An important part of the growing company is the emphasis on Privacy and protecting consumer and employee’s data.  Additionally, with the advent of the various privacy legislative efforts, (GDPR, CCPA, etc.) Visa continues to be at the forefront of managing privacy.  As such, the Visa Privacy Program is a key component towards this goal.

The Data Platform (DP) department is overall technical program manager of Visa's Privacy program.  This position will provide analysis and technical support for the Privacy Program.  Specifically, the Privacy analyst position will help in these efforts by:

·       Gathering, analyzing, coordinating, information regarding the personal information (PI) within the Visa ecosystem

·       Provide reporting and analysis regarding the PI information

·       Coordinating application’s design and planning to address regulatory requirements

·       Provide support for the overall PI scanning effort, within the DP, and with other divisions.

·       Provide PI scanning analysis and results.

·       General support of the Privacy Program

 

The ideal candidate will have a very strong technical background in one or more of the following areas:

1.       Relational database concepts:  Modeling, tables, indexes, keys, etc

2.       Big Data stack concepts:  Hadoop, HBase, No SQL, Spark, Kafka databases

3.       Expert level in SQL across a variety of platforms

4.       Experience with a variety of operating systems (e.g., Unix, Linux, IBM Mainframe, Windows)

5.       PI Scanning and discovery

6.       Technical vendor interaction, management and support.

7.       Expert level with MS Office:  MS Access (required), Excel (required), PowerPoint, Word
